Mission Kitchen, New Covent Garden Market, SW8 5EL

Mission Kitchen is a shared workspace for London's independent food businesses. It supports a community of more than 100 food and drink entrepreneurs. This project is supported by the Mayor of London.

About

Background

Mission Kitchen opened its doors in June 2021. The project was born out of a partnership between Mission Kitchen's management team and Covent Garden Market Authority, with the intention of delivering a new space within New Covent Garden Market that could act as a platform for emerging talent in London's food and drink sector. The site was funded by the Mayor of London's regeneration fund, the Good Growth fund based on its commitment to delivering social impact by supporting early-stage businesses, creating employment and training opportunities, and championing entrepreneurs from under-represented groups.

Design

The site consists of a combination of commercial kitchens, co-working and office spaces and event venues. It was retro-fitted into an empty, shell-and-core floor-plate originally designed for office use.

The main feature is a large commercial kitchen space, which has been subdivided into a number of areas designed to support shared use by multiple food businesses. The innovative design allows food and drink businesses to choose from a range of flexible membership options, with options suitable for businesses of all sizes.

The site also offers extensive co-working and office space, where members can work on all other aspects of their business outside of the kitchen; as well as event spaces where regular public and private talks, workshops, networking and dining events are hosted.

Additional features include a Development Kitchen, available for flexible hire by external organisations for product development, training and content creation; an outdoor terrace used for events, meetings and small-scale food growing; and a packaging and fulfilment area where members can manage inventory and prepare orders for distribution across the nation.

Community

The Mission Kitchen community is made up of more than 100 small, independent businesses working across all areas of the food industry. This includes artisan producers, up-and-coming food brands, caterers, street food traders, freelancers and creatives.

Location

New Covent Garden Market is the UK's largest fresh produce market, specialising in fruit, vegetables and flowers. Set across 35 acres in Central London, it houses more than 150 wholesale businesses. The market is undergoing an extensive redevelopment, modernising and reinvigorating the market, and introducing new food-related uses.

Mission Kitchen has been developed within the newly created Food Exchange Building, a hub for food enterprise which is home to a wide variety of businesses trading in products from ice cream and wine, to peanut butter and plant-based meat alternatives.
